概括
在创伤性脑损伤 (TBI) 后给药的静脉免疫调节纳米粒子 (IMPs) 可减少炎症并改善结果. IMPs是安全的,在6小时内有效,并显示出前医院TBI治疗的前景.

背景情况:
- 创伤性脑损伤 (TBI) 引发了涉及单细胞/巨细胞透的炎症反应,导致二次损伤.
- 目前对TBI的治疗方法往往无法解决关键的早期炎症级联.
- 开发有效的干预措施以减轻TBI诱导的神经炎症对于改善患者结果至关重要.
研究的目的:
- 评估静脉注射免疫调节纳米颗粒 (IMP) 在减轻TBI诱导的二次损伤方面的疗效和安全性.
- 为了确定IMP在TBI后的剂量反应关系和治疗窗口.
- 调查IMP对TBI后神经和非神经细胞基因表达变化的影响.
主要方法:
- 在临床前模型中,在TBI诱导后,以不同的剂量和时间点静脉注射IMP.
- 评估行为缺陷,病变体积和炎症细胞透.
- 单细胞RNA测序用于分析TBI和IMP治疗后脑细胞中的基因表达特征.
主要成果:
- IMP的使用显著降低了炎症细胞透,病变大小和行为缺陷.
- 观察到一种剂量与反应的关系,在耐受良好剂量时出现平原.
- 创伤后至少6小时的有效治疗窗口,在12小时后有一些好处.
- IMPs改善了TBI诱导的基因表达变化,包括血管光滑肌细胞中意想不到的改变.
结论:
- 静脉注射的IMP是一种有希望的,无毒的TBI治疗策略,可以限制二次损伤并改善结果.
- IMPs表现出良好的安全性和广泛的治疗窗口,适合在伤害后立即使用.
- IMP治疗有效调节神经炎症反应,并防止细胞水平上有害的基因表达变化.

DefinitionTraumatic brain injury, or TBI, is a disturbance of normal brain function induced by an external mechanical force, such as a direct blow to the head or a penetrating injury. It can affect both brain structure and function, producing a wide range of clinical outcomes. TBI is a heterogeneous condition, meaning its effects may differ based on the type, location, and severity of the injury.Basis of ClassificationTBI is classified based on severity, injury mechanism, or pathophysiology. Early Ischemia and Ionic ImbalanceWithin minutes of spinal cord injury, a secondary cascade begins, progressing over hours to weeks. Vascular damage reduces blood flow, causing ischemia and mitochondrial dysfunction. ATP depletion leads to ion pump failure, membrane depolarization, sodium influx, potassium efflux, and water accumulation, resulting in cellular swelling.
